Liveblocks
Visit WebsiteLiveblocks Overview
Liveblocks is a comprehensive collaboration engine designed for modern product development. It provides developers with a suite of ready-made, fully customizable features that can be integrated into any application with just a few lines of code. The platform's core mission is to eliminate the immense complexity and time investment required to build real-time collaborative functionalities and AI-powered assistants from scratch, allowing development teams to focus on their core product and ship faster.
At its heart, Liveblocks is an infrastructure-as-a-service for collaboration. It offers a robust, battle-tested platform built for scale, reliability, and security, trusted by leading companies to power experiences for millions of users. Whether you're building a creative tool, a project management app, a documentation platform, or a data analysis dashboard, Liveblocks provides the foundational blocks to make it multiplayer and intelligent.
How to use Liveblocks
Using Liveblocks is designed to be a seamless experience for developers familiar with modern web frameworks. The process generally follows these steps:
- Sign Up & Get API Keys: Start by creating a free account on the Liveblocks website to get your public and secret API keys.
- Install the SDK: Liveblocks provides dedicated client-side libraries for popular frameworks like React, Next.js, Vue, Svelte, and vanilla JavaScript. You can install the relevant package using npm or yarn (e.g.,
npm install @liveblocks/react). - Set up Authentication: Secure your application by creating an authentication endpoint on your backend. When a user tries to access a collaborative space (a "Room"), your frontend will request an access token from this endpoint. Liveblocks provides helpers for Node.js to simplify this process.
- Create a Liveblocks Room: A "Room" is the central concept in Liveblocks, representing a single collaborative session or document. You wrap the part of your application you want to make collaborative with the Liveblocks RoomProvider component.
- Implement Features: With the Room set up, you can now use Liveblocks' hooks and components to add features. For example, use the
useOthers()hook to get information about other users in the room and render their avatars, or use theuseStorage()hook to sync data structures in real-time. For AI and comments, you can drop in pre-built React components like<AiChat />and<Comments />for instant functionality. - Customize: All components and APIs are highly customizable. You can tailor the look and feel to match your product's branding and extend the functionality using webhooks and REST APIs to integrate with your backend services, such as sending email notifications or syncing data to your database.
Core Features of Liveblocks
- AI Copilots: Easily embed in-app AI agents. These copilots can be given knowledge about your application's data and registered with custom tools to perform actions, creating an experience similar to Notion AI or Microsoft Copilot.
- Multiplayer Editing & Presence: Enable real-time, simultaneous editing of documents, designs, or any data structure. The presence feature shows who is currently online and active, with live cursors and selection indicators, just like in Figma or Google Docs.
- Comments & Annotations: Add contextual commenting threads anywhere in your application. Users can tag others, resolve threads, and have focused discussions directly on the content they are working on.
- Notifications: A complete notification system with an inbox-like UI component. It intelligently alerts users to relevant activities, such as mentions in comments or updates to tasks.
- Robust Infrastructure & APIs: Built on a scalable WebSocket infrastructure with 99.99% uptime. It includes a powerful REST API, webhooks for server-side integration, and a monitoring dashboard to analyze usage.
- Broad Framework Support: First-class support for React, Next.js, Vue, Nuxt.js, Svelte, SvelteKit, Astro, and more, along with deep integration with state management libraries like Redux and Zustand, and text editors like Lexical and Tiptap.
- Enterprise-Ready Security: Compliant with SOC 2 and offers features for HIPAA compliance, ensuring data is handled securely.
Use Cases for Liveblocks
Liveblocks is versatile and can be used to power a wide range of applications:
- Creative & Design Tools: Building collaborative whiteboards like Miro, 3D design tools like Spline, or graphic design platforms like Canva.
- Productivity & Business Software: Creating collaborative documents like Google Docs, spreadsheets like Google Sheets, or presentation tools.
- Developer Tools: Adding multiplayer features to code editors or collaborative debugging sessions.
- SaaS Products: Enhancing any SaaS application with features like contextual comments for review workflows, AI assistants to help users navigate the product, or dashboards showing real-time team activity.
- Education & E-Learning: Building interactive online classrooms where students and teachers can collaborate on a shared digital canvas.
Advantages of Liveblocks
The primary advantage of Liveblocks is accelerating product development. Teams can save months of complex engineering work by leveraging pre-built, reliable solutions. This allows them to stay focused on their unique value proposition. Furthermore, adding collaborative and AI features significantly boosts user engagement, adoption, and retention. It can also unlock new revenue opportunities by allowing companies to offer these advanced features as part of premium, usage-based, or enterprise plans. The platform's commitment to a superior developer experience, with excellent documentation and scalable infrastructure, makes it a trusted partner for growth.
Pricing and Plans
Liveblocks operates on a freemium model, making it accessible for projects of all sizes. The pricing structure typically includes:
- Free Plan: A generous free tier designed for hobby projects, prototyping, and getting started. It includes a certain number of monthly active users, connections, and storage, allowing developers to build and test full-featured applications without any initial cost.
- Pro Plan: A usage-based plan that scales with your product's growth. You pay for what you use based on metrics like monthly active users, peak concurrent connections, and data storage. This plan includes higher limits and additional features.
- Enterprise Plan: A custom plan for large-scale applications with specific needs for security, support, and compliance (like HIPAA). It offers features like dedicated support, custom contracts, and guaranteed uptime SLAs.
This model allows startups to get off the ground for free and seamlessly scale their costs as their user base grows.
Liveblocks Comments (0)
Log in to post comments
Log in nowLiveblocksWebsite Traffic Analysis
Latest Traffic
Status
Monthly Traffic Trend
Geography
Top 5 Countries/Regions
-
🇮🇳 India30.62%
-
🇺🇸 United States23.54%
-
🇻🇳 Vietnam17.52%
-
🇨🇦 Canada14.95%
-
🇳🇬 Nigeria13.37%
Traffic source
| Source Type | Percentage |
|---|---|
|
Direct Access
|
77.33% |
|
Referral
|
21.78% |
|
Email
|
0.89% |
Popular Keywords
| Keyword | Cost Per Click |
|---|---|
|
$1.14
|
|
|
$4.15
|
|
|
$0.00
|
|
|
$0.00
|
|
|
$0.51
|
Liveblocks Alternatives
View All
Velt
Velt is an AI-powered SDK for developers to rapidly integrate rich collaboration features like comments, co-editing, and live …
Velt is an AI-powered SDK for developers to rapidly integrate rich collaboration features like comments, co-editing, and live presence into any web application. It saves months of development time, boosts user engagement, and allows teams to ship features 5x faster.
LiveKit
LiveKit is an all-in-one, open-source platform for building, deploying, and scaling real-time voice and video AI agents. It …
LiveKit is an all-in-one, open-source platform for building, deploying, and scaling real-time voice and video AI agents. It provides ultra-low latency infrastructure, powerful APIs, and state-of-the-art AI tools to enable developers to create conversational AI, robotics, and live streaming applications with enterprise-grade reliability and scalability.
Tencent RTC
A comprehensive developer platform providing powerful APIs and SDKs for real-time voice, video, chat, and live streaming. Tencent …
A comprehensive developer platform providing powerful APIs and SDKs for real-time voice, video, chat, and live streaming. Tencent RTC enables businesses to build scalable, low-latency, and interactive communication experiences directly into their applications across various industries.
MirrorFly
MirrorFly is a leading AI-powered CPaaS (Communication Platform as a Service) provider, offering customizable video, voice, and chat …
MirrorFly is a leading AI-powered CPaaS (Communication Platform as a Service) provider, offering customizable video, voice, and chat APIs & SDKs. It enables developers to integrate high-quality, real-time communication features into any web or mobile application, supporting millions of concurrent users with a rich set of over 1000 features.
CodeSandbox
CodeSandbox is an instant cloud development environment that enables developers to build, share, and collaborate on web applications. …
CodeSandbox is an instant cloud development environment that enables developers to build, share, and collaborate on web applications. It provides scalable, secure sandboxes for any project, from quick prototypes to full-stack applications, and now features a powerful SDK for integrating code execution into AI agents.
Vapi
Vapi is a developer-first API platform for building, deploying, and scaling advanced, human-like voice AI agents. It enables …
Vapi is a developer-first API platform for building, deploying, and scaling advanced, human-like voice AI agents. It enables the creation of sophisticated conversational AI for inbound/outbound calls, in-app assistants, and more, with ultra-low latency and high configurability.
Outspeed
An API and SDK for developers to build and deploy AI voice companions with real-time emotion and memory. …
An API and SDK for developers to build and deploy AI voice companions with real-time emotion and memory. Easily integrate natural, low-latency voice interactions into web and mobile applications.
Dyte
Dyte is a developer-focused SDK platform for easily embedding high-quality, customizable, and secure live video and audio experiences …
Dyte is a developer-focused SDK platform for easily embedding high-quality, customizable, and secure live video and audio experiences into any application. It provides pre-built UI components, powerful plugins, and a robust backend, enabling developers to build interactive communication features for industries like telehealth, ed-tech, and virtual events with minimal effort, all while prioritizing security with SOC2 and HIPAA compliance.
TwelveLabs
TwelveLabs is a powerful multimodal AI platform for video understanding. It provides APIs and SDKs for developers to …
TwelveLabs is a powerful multimodal AI platform for video understanding. It provides APIs and SDKs for developers to build applications that can search, analyze, and generate text from video content. By understanding visuals, audio, and speech, it unlocks deep insights from large video libraries.
kallo.ai
kallo.ai is an advanced AI collaboration platform designed for teams. It streamlines information processing and decision-making through features …
kallo.ai is an advanced AI collaboration platform designed for teams. It streamlines information processing and decision-making through features like side-by-side AI model comparisons, real-time document analysis, and seamless integration with leading models like GPT-4o and Claude 3.5.
Liveblocks Category
Liveblocks Tag
Liveblocks AI Tool Comparison
Liveblocks Embed Feature
Just copy the embed code below and paste this beautiful badge on your blog, article, or official app website to drive traffic directly to this tool's detail page and quickly boost your exposure and user count!
No comments yet, be the first to comment!